2.5.59

February 21, 2015

This is a major update with performance and operational enhancements to streamline reading and navigation! New initial displays - iPad - In landscape, the display initially shows a single page and the headline index. In portrait, a single page is scaled to fit-width. - iPhone/iTouch - In landscape, the display initially shows a two page spread. In portrait, a single page is scaled to fit-height. Tap and read/zoom: - A single tap on a story, ad or graphic will display that item in a - A double tap on a page and display will zoom where tapped. A second double tap returns page to default size. Pinch page any time to zoom. - Change default tap actions for single, double and two-finger taps in Options > Settings screen. New designs and organization: - New fonts, layouts, icons and labels simplify and ease use Read off-line or on-line: - Faster on-line reading, uses less bandwidth - Select edition to download for off-line reading or select off-line reading as the default - Special low-bandwidth mode ideal when roaming Push Notifications: -Receive availability alerts for new editions Performance: - Improved iOS8 and Retina display compliance - Enhanced page and type display quality - Faster downloading and display, improved gesture response - Stability improvements and general bug fixing - Updates to improve Twitter and Facebook support

Description of Medina Gazette

Our new mobile app gives users a complete news experience on-the-go, produced by an award-winning news staff. Choose "Live News" to get alerts on breaking local and national topics and read community news, sports and feature reporting enhanced with vivid photos and photos and videos from www.medina-gazette.com. Choose "E-Edition" to page through our daily Gazette digital replica and special editions for a newspaper feel with technological perk including a crystal-clear view of every word, coupon and advertisement available with streamlined navigation, social sharing and an audio reader. A subscription is required to view some of the content on this app Owned by Lorain County Printing and Publishing.
